Code P0627 Cadillac Description

The Engine Control Module (ECM) supplies voltage to the fuel pump driver control module for 30 s when the ignition is on and continuously when the engine is running. While this voltage is being received, a serial data signal containing the desired fuel pump speed is also received from the ECM. After the voltage and data have been received the fuel pump driver control module actuates the brushless fuel pump by means of a high power three phase signal. The Diagnostic Trouble Code (DTC) will be set when the Fuel Pump Speed Output Circuit is open for greater than 2 s.

What are the Possible Causes of the DTC P0627 Cadillac?

  • Faulty Fuel Pump Driver Control Module
  • Fuel Pump Driver Control Module harness is open or shorted
  • Fuel Pump Driver Control Module circuit poor electrical connection
  • Faulty Engine Control Module (ECM)

How to Fix the DTC P0627 Cadillac?

Review the 'Possible Causes' above and visually examine the corresponding wiring harness and connectors. Check for damaged components and inspect connector pins for signs of being broken, bent, pushed out, or corroded.

What is the Cost to Diagnose the Code?

Labor: 1.0

To diagnose the P0627 Cadillac code, it typically requires 1.0 hour of labor. Rates vary by location, vehicle, and shop. Many shops charge between $80–$150 per hour; dealerships and metro areas may be higher, independents may be lower.

Frequently Asked Questions about P0627 Cadillac Code

1. What does the OBDII code P0627 mean on a Cadillac?

P0627 indicates an issue with the fuel pump speed output circuit, which impacts the fuel pump's ability to operate properly.

2. What are the common symptoms of a P0627 code in a Cadillac?

Symptoms may include engine stalling, difficulty starting, poor acceleration, and a check engine light.

3. What causes the P0627 code on a Cadillac?

Common causes include a faulty fuel pump, damaged wiring or connectors in the fuel pump circuit, a malfunctioning fuel pump control module, or an ECM issue.

4. Can I drive my Cadillac with a P0627 code?

Driving with this code may result in poor vehicle performance or stalling. It’s best to address the issue promptly to avoid being stranded.

5. How do I diagnose the P0627 code on my Cadillac?

Start by inspecting the fuel pump wiring and connectors for damage. Use a multimeter to check voltage at the fuel pump and test the fuel pump control module.

6. How do I fix the P0627 code on a Cadillac?

Repairs may include replacing the fuel pump, repairing damaged wiring, replacing the fuel pump control module, or reprogramming the ECM if necessary.

7. How much does it cost to fix the P0627 code on a Cadillac?

Repair costs can range from $100 to $1,000 depending on whether it's a simple wiring repair or a fuel pump replacement.

8. Could a dirty fuel filter cause a P0627 code?

A dirty fuel filter is unlikely to cause this code, as it specifically relates to the fuel pump speed circuit rather than fuel flow issues.

9. Is the P0627 code related to other fuel system codes?

Yes, it may be accompanied by other codes like P0087 (low fuel rail pressure) if the fuel pump is not delivering adequate pressure.

10. Does the P0627 code always mean the fuel pump is bad?

No, the issue could stem from wiring, connectors, the control module, or even a software problem in the ECM. Proper diagnosis is essential.
